Bosnia and Herzegovina - Surface Production of Brown Coal
Since 2014, Bosnia and Herzegovina Surface Production of Brown Coal rose 4.5% year on year. With 12,308.14 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, the country was number 9 comparing other countries in Surface Production of Brown Coal. Bosnia and Herzegovina is overtaken by Romania, which was number 8 at 21,237.54 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Hungary at 6,847 Thousand Metric Tons. Germany lead the ranking with 131,314 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, a decrease of 21% compared to 2018. Turkey, Poland and Serbia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Turkey witnessed the best average annual growth at +9.2% per year, while Spain was the worst growing country at -100% per year.
